Short Distance and Easy Road Connectivity
One of the biggest advantages is that Gorakhpur is well-connected to Nepal via the Sunauli border.
The route is simple:
Gorakhpur → Sunauli Border → Bhairahawa → Kathmandu / Pokhara
This makes Nepal an ideal destination for travelers looking for a low cost Gorakhpur to Kathmandu trip by road.
Best Time to Visit Nepal from Gorakhpur in 2026
Choosing the right travel season helps you save money and enjoy better weather.
Cheapest Months for Travel
If your goal is budget travel, consider visiting during the off-season:
-
January to February
-
Between mid-July and early September
During these months, hotels and tour packages are cheaper because tourist crowds are lower.
Best Weather for Sightseeing
For pleasant weather and clear mountain views, the best months are:
-
March through May during the spring season
-
October through December during the autumn season
These seasons are perfect for sightseeing in Kathmandu and Pokhara.
How to Reach Nepal from Gorakhpur on a Low Budget
Travel cost is the biggest part of your trip budget. Luckily, reaching Nepal from Gorakhpur is easy and affordable.
Low Cost Gorakhpur to Kathmandu Trip by Road
The cheapest way to travel is by road:
-
Take a bus or train from Gorakhpur to Sunauli
-
Cross the border at Sunauli (no visa required for Indians)
-
From Bhairahawa, take a tourist bus or shared jeep to Kathmandu or Pokhara
Road travel is budget-friendly and allows you to enjoy scenic landscapes along the way.

Cheap Gorakhpur to Nepal Trip Plan 2026 (Suggested Itinerary)
A good itinerary helps you cover more places without overspending.
3 Days Budget Nepal Trip Plan
If you have limited time, this short trip works well:
Day 1: Gorakhpur to Lumbini
-
Cross Sunauli border
-
Explore the sacred Maya Devi Temple
-
Explore monasteries
Day 2: Lumbini to Pokhara
-
Travel by bus
-
Enjoy a relaxing evening stroll along Phewa Lake
Day 3: Pokhara to Kathmandu
-
Visit Sarangkot sunrise
-
Drive to Kathmandu and explore local markets
5 Days Affordable Nepal Vacation from Gorakhpur in 2026
A 5-day plan gives you a complete Nepal experience:
Day 1: Gorakhpur → Lumbini
Day 2: Lumbini → Pokhara sightseeing
Day 3: Pokhara → Kathmandu travel
Day 4: Kathmandu temples + city tour
Day 5: Nagarkot sunrise + return journey
This itinerary is ideal for families, couples, and group travelers.
Estimated Cost Breakdown for Nepal Budget Tour (2026)
Let’s look at the approximate cost of a cheap Nepal trip from Gorakhpur.
Travel Cost
-
Gorakhpur to Sunauli bus/train: ₹300–₹700
-
Border to Kathmandu tourist bus: ₹800–₹1500
-
Local transport: ₹500–₹1000
Total travel cost: ₹2000–₹3500
Hotel and Food Budget
Nepal has many affordable stay options:
-
Low-cost hotels are usually available for ₹800–₹1500 each night
-
Homestays: ₹600–₹1000 per night
-
Meals in local restaurants: ₹150–₹300
Total stay + food (5 days): ₹4000–₹7000
Sightseeing & Entry Fees
-
Temple entry: Free or low cost
-
Cable car rides: ₹500–₹800
-
Adventure activities (optional): ₹1500–₹3000
Sightseeing budget: ₹1500–₹4000
Total Cheap Nepal Trip Cost (2026 Estimate)
A complete budget trip can cost:
✅ ₹10,000 to ₹18,000 per person (3–5 days)
That’s why Nepal is one of the best affordable foreign trips from India.

Top Places to Visit on a Cheap Nepal Trip
Nepal is full of beautiful and cultural attractions.
Kathmandu (Culture + Temples)
Kathmandu is the heart of Nepal.
Must-visit places:
-
Pashupatinath Temple
-
Swayambhunath Buddhist Stupa, famous as the Monkey Temple
-
Boudhanath Stupa
-
Durbar Square
Kathmandu is ideal for history lovers.
Pokhara (Lakes + Mountains)
Pokhara is known for peace and nature.
Top attractions:
-
Phewa Lake boating
-
Sarangkot sunrise view
-
Davis Falls
-
World Peace Pagoda
It’s a must for couples and nature lovers.
Lumbini (Peace + Spirituality)
Lumbini is the birthplace of Lord Buddha.
Highlights:
-
Maya Devi Temple
-
International monasteries
-
Meditation centers
A perfect stop for spiritual travelers.

Important Travel Requirements for Indians Visiting Nepal
Indian tourists enjoy easy entry into Nepal.
Documents Needed in 2026
You can travel without a visa.
Carry any one:
-
Aadhaar Card
-
Voter ID
-
Passport (optional)
Currency and Mobile Network Tips
-
Indian currency is accepted in many places
-
Keep Nepali Rupees for small purchases
-
Local SIM cards are cheap for internet access
